J. Kumar Infraprojects Limited has secured a significant contract from the Mumbai Metropolitan Region Development Authority (MMRDA) valued at ₹1,847.72 crore (excluding GST). The company received a Letter of Acceptance for the design and construction of a key elevated road in Thane city, stretching from Anand Nagar to Saket on the Eastern Express Highway. This large-scale infrastructure project aims to improve road connectivity and alleviate traffic congestion in the rapidly developing region of Thane.
The elevated road project is scheduled for completion within a 48-month period from the date of commencement. The scope of work includes detailed designing, construction, and development of the elevated corridor, providing a more streamlined and efficient transportation network for the city.
